

On August 23, 2010, Don passed away at Mercy Medical Center
with family and friends at his side.
Don was born on the farm in Leonard, North Dakota, and never lost his love for the land, being an advid gardener all his life.
During his youth, he was a member of the Civil Conservation Corp. in Utah. He is a veteran of the U.S. Army having served in WWII, in North Africa, and Burma Theaters. After returning from WWII, to Fargo, North Dakota in 1948 he moved his family to Redding, CA where his daughter was born. In the early 50's Don was an independant jobber for the Union Ice Company delivering ice for home use, and commercial business, also for Lassen National Park, and heating oil for homes in the Redding area. After retirement from McColl's Dairy, Don and his wife Lorraine enjoyed camping at the coast, fishing and traveling, especially to Canada and Alaska, and visiting relatives in Washington and the midwest.
He is survived by his wife of 68 years, Lorraine; son, Larry Kensinger and his wife, Barbara, of Cottonwood, his daughter, Claudia Robinson, and her husband, Richard, and one granddaughter, Amber Robinson, of Redding; his sister, Ruth Riebe, of Spokane, WA, and numerous nieces and nephews throughout the United States.
